Rekeying a lock

You can call an expert locksmith if you've locked your keys in your car, or lost them. They can disassemble your lock, replace the pins, and re-key the locks to make them work using a new key. This is typically a less expensive option than replacing the lock, and it can also provide a sense of security. It is essential to inquire with the locksmith how much the service will cost before you hire them. Some companies charge more, while other offer discounts on specific services.

Rekeying your locks is a great idea after moving into a home. This will ensure that only your key functions and that no one else has access to your property. It is also a good idea to take this precaution if you suspect someone is stealing your keys or has copies of them.

Rekeying a lock is much more affordable than replacing it, and doesn't affect the quality of the lock. In fact, it's quite secure because only the key that matches the lock rekeyed can open it. A professional locksmith can rekey your lock in no time. If you want to upgrade the locks at your home, it's best to replace them all.

Car key replacement

Car key replacement is the process of replacing the car key that was lost or a damaged one. It involves cutting out a new blank key and programming it in accordance with the computer of your vehicle. This is a complicated job that requires special equipment and a lot of training. There are many aspects that impact the price of this service, including the type of key and the vehicle make. The cost of a replacement key for a newer model vehicle will be more expensive than one for a model older. There are two kinds of keys: a mechanical one that locks and unlocks your car and remote start keys which allows you to lock and open the car remotely. The price of the key is also determined by whether it has chip transponders.

There are certain car dealerships that have in-house locksmiths. However, these services are usually more expensive than those provided by independent locksmiths. Dealer service centers may not have all the tools necessary to open your car and program your keys. A local locksmith or an automotive locksmith replacement key locksmith can help you save up to 50% when replacing your car keys.

Key extraction

It can be a major problem if your key is broken in the lock. It can also leave your property at a higher risk of theft, and also prevent you from locking your doors when you leave. A locksmith can fix this problem without causing damage to your door or lock. They have the right tools and techniques that can help you get the broken piece from your lock, therefore it's a good idea to call them if you require emergency assistance.

You could try a few DIY methods to get the broken key from the locked door. You can retrieve the broken fragment of key using pliers, a pair or needle-nose pliers, or a magnet. However this method can only work if there is still a decent amount of the key sticking out of the lock. You may damage the lock when you push the damaged piece further into it.

A jigsaw can be used to remove the broken fragment of the key from the lock. It is recommended to do this in a well lit environment. However it is essential that you use a thin blade. This will decrease the friction between the blade and the lock and it will make it easier to extract the fragment. A lubrication spray can help reduce the friction.

Car key programming

The procedure of programming blank chips into a new car key or fob is to re-program it to ensure that the settings of the vehicle are matched. To be successful, it requires the use of advanced tools and extensive training. It is therefore important to engage a professional perform the task. The cost of this service will be contingent on the kind of key or fob and the type of signal it has. Older keys typically have simpler signals that can be captured with a simple remote key copying device while newer smart keys use encrypted signals that are more difficult understand.

In contrast to older mechanical keys, modern car keys contain transponder chips that connect to your vehicle's computer system to allow it to start. Key fobs like these can be an excellent convenience, however they're also more expensive to replace than traditional keys. This is because they have to be programmed by a locksmith or auto dealer to function.

Although it might be tempting to attempt to program your own fob or key however, it can be risky. The majority of modern vehicles have sophisticated anti-theft systems that require a certain code to function. This can only be programmed by an auto mechanic or locksmith. The locksmith will also need to reprogram the PCB of your car. This is a long and complicated procedure. It is best to leave the work to an experienced locksmith. A professional locksmith will have the latest tools, diagnostics, and software to speed up the process and more accurate.

The cost of a new key fob or a replacement for an existing key, is usually between $100-$150. This includes the cost of blank keys and the cutting. In some instances keys may contain an electronic circuit inside that needs to be replaced in addition, which can add another $50-$100 to the cost of the job.
